This fixes an appending of the how message when it is longer than 20. This is the case in some translations such as the french one where the colon gets appended to the file: supprim=C3=A9 par nous :wt-status.c modifi=C3=A9 des deux c=C3=B4t=C3=A9s :wt-status.h Additionally, having a space makes the file in question easier to selec= t in console to quickly address the problem. Without the space, the colon (and, sometimes the last word) of the message is selected along with th= e file.
